View a map of this area and more on Natural Atlas.The brown pelican is a large grayish-brown bird with a distinct pouched bill. During the breeding season, the plumage (feathers) turns bright yellow on the head and white on the neck, which both fade to dull yellow and brown during non-breeding. (Florida Natural Areas Inventory 2001). Juvenile birds are almost completely brown with a whitish belly. White Pelicans. Bill DeGiulio. Brown skin on their giant throat patch. Dark gray bodies with a white neck and pale yellow head. Measures 3.5 – 5 feet in length (1 to 1.5 m) with a wingspan of 6.5 – 7.5 feet (2 to 2.3 m). The weight of adults can range from 4.4 to 11.0 lb (2 to 5 kg). The Pelican Pub is a sports bar located on A1A in St....Mar 13, 2017 · Pelican Island is a small mangrove island in the Indian River waterway of east-central Florida, about 50 miles south of Cape Canaveral. Although only 5.5 acres when designated as a reserve, the island had long captured the attention of bird watchers—and bird hunters. On Wikipedia. Pelican Island National Wildlife Refuge is a United States National Wildlife Refuge located just off the western coast of Orchid Island in the Indian River Lagoon east of Sebastian, Florida. The refuge consists of a 3-acre (12,000 m2) island that includes an additional 2.5 acres (10,000 m2) of surrounding water and is located off ...The Pelicans on Amelia Island, Fernandina Beach, Florida. 740 likes · 651 were here. ... For reservation and pricing information, please contact Sunset Resort Rentals at (850) 665-7889 or visit … Critical times occurred in the decades of the 1960s, 1980s, and 1990s. During these uncertain times, the local citizens would stand up to defend Pelican Island. In the 1960s, the threat came from Florida’s Trustees of the Internal Improvement policy of selling state-owned submerged land to developers and permitting these lands to be filled. Pelican Island holds a unique place in American history, because on March 14, 1903, President Theodore Roosevelt designated it as the Nation's first National Wildlife Refuge to protect brown pelicans and other native birds nesting on the island. Pelican Island National Wildlife Refuge is located within the Indian River Lagoon, the most biologically diverse estuary in the United States.
